out of one's tree

English

Prepositional phrase

out of one's tree

  1. (slang) Crazy; unhinged; irrational.
    • 2003, Diane Chamberlain, Kiss River, Mira (2003), →ISBN, page 79:
      Clay had learned to bring a book with him when he took Henry shopping; otherwise, he would go out of his tree with boredom.
    • 2009, Terry Stocker, The Paleolithic Paradigm, AuthorHouse (2009), →ISBN, page 324:
      I, again jokingly finalized: that to believe her own hypothesis, she had to be out of her tree, []
    • 2010, Helen Simpson, In-Flight Entertainment: Stories, Knopf (2010), →ISBN, unnumbered page:
      He was singing and sobbing and carrying on, out of his tree with alcohol, []
    • For more examples of usage of this term, see Citations:out of one's tree.

Synonyms

  • off one's tree, out of one's box, out of one's gourd, out of one's head, out of one's mind, out of one's skull, out there
  • See also Thesaurus:insane.

Antonyms

  • in one's right mind
  • See also Thesaurus:sane.
